compiler: Change shader_info->tes.vertex_order into a ccw boolean.

The vertex order is either clockwise or counterclockwise.  We can just
store a "ccw" boolean rather than GLenum values.  I don't want to use
GLenums in a Vulkan driver, and even in GL a simple boolean works fine.
